DESCRIPTION
A SDL2::HapticCustom is exclusively for the SDL_HAPTIC_CUSTOM effect.
A custom force feedback effect is much like a periodic effect, where the application can define its exact shape. You will have to allocate the data yourself. Data should consist of channels * samples Uint16 samples.
If channels is one, the effect is rotated using the defined direction. Otherwise it uses the samples in data for the different axes.
Fields
type-SDL_HAPTIC_CUSTOMdirection- Direction of the effectlength- Duration of the effectdelay- Delay before starting the effectchannels- Axes to use, minimum of oneperiod- Sample periodssamples- Amount of samplesdata- Should containchannels*samplesitemsattack_length- Duration of the attackattack_level- Level at the start of the attackfade_length- Duration of the fadefade_level- Level at the end of the fade
